Transaction 78890dda9400b3bd34ce68402f74c4f746b9aa211bfeca5d260482765a766053
1 Input
1 Output
-
78890dda9400b3bd34ce68402f74c4f746b9aa211bfeca5d260482765a766053:0
- value
- 13193868
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feb1767c83bd504c5af9bd4362428ad90a98283
- address
- bc1qhl43we7g802sf3d0n02rvfpg4kg2nq5rt4hxsr